"use client"; import { useState, useEffect } from "react"; import { motion, AnimatePresence } from "framer-motion"; import Link from "next/link"; export function StickyBookingBar() { const [visible, setVisible] = useState(false); useEffect(() => { const handleScroll = () => { setVisible(window.scrollY > 600); }; window.addEventListener("scroll", handleScroll, { passive: true }); return () => window.removeEventListener("scroll", handleScroll); }, []); return ( {visible && (

From

€89/person

Book Now
)}
); }